Study On The Establishment Of Vegetative Cover Of The Qinghai-Tibet Railway Base From Dang Xiong To Yang Bajin

An experiment was carried out in Yang Bajin Town, which simulated the enviroment of the railway base slopes and 13 kinds of herbaceous plants were sown alone and 5 kinds were sown with compounds of them. There were totally 18 kinds of cold-resistant and drought-resistant herbaceous plants were selected in this experiment. The results were as follows:(1) Because of the terrible climate there, the small enviroment of the railway base slopes was even worse. The growth and development of the species from the pulse family were limited. Compared to the warm place ,the seed quantity should be increased in order to retrieve the individualities'hypodevelopment by the population dnensity.(2) Among all the species Elymus nutans Griseb and Rumes K-1 performed best with higher germination rates seperately 97.5%, 95%, coverage rates 87.8%, 71.2% and overyearing rates 97.5% and 100%, which showed that they both had strong tolerance to the oxygen deficiency, higher evaporation capacity and great temperature difference between day and night, so they had good adaptability to the enviroment of the railway base. According the previous study, Elymus nutans Griseb and Rumes K-1 were the predominant species in the artificial grassland here. There were many studies on the models of their introduction and growth and at the same time people also found Elymus nutans Griseb had a good performance when it was sown with other species. Therefore, Elymus nutans Griseb and Rumes K-1 both could be uesed as the basic species to be planted on the railway base slopes.(3) Symphytum asperum which was with deep and perennial roots, not only had a good germination rate(100%) and overyearing rate but also had adaptation reaction for the alpine cold wheather. However, its invasion speed was not that good and the vegetative coverge was lower(the average coverage degree was 39.8%), so it should be sown with other Gramineae grass which had higher invasion capacity and higher coverage degree.(4) The local grass Elymus sibiricus Linn had a germination rate 93.4%, which was a little lower compared to Elymus nutans Grise, Symphytum asperum and Rumes K-1, but its coverage degree(61.4%) was higher than Symphytum asperum. It had some advantages to other species from other places. As a result, it could be sown with other species to increase the complexity and stability of the community.(5) The 5 turfgrass species performed well in the first year, but their overyearing rate were low and degenearted quickly.
